From ef3631220d2b3d8d14cf64464760505baa60d6ac Mon Sep 17 00:00:00 2001 From: Marek Vasut Date: Tue, 5 Jan 2021 15:11:51 +0100 Subject: net: ks8851: Register MDIO bus and the internal PHY The KS8851 has a reduced internal PHY, which is accessible through its registers at offset 0xe4. The PHY is compatible with KS886x PHY present in Micrel switches, except the PHY ID Low/High registers are swapped. Register MDIO bus so this PHY can be detected and probed by phylib.
